Default Paypal have sent the debt collectors 'round.

I few months ago, my paypal account went to minus £130 ($260) because a cheating scoundrel on Ebay did a charge back on his credit card. (I think I posted about the situation, on this forum)

I stopped using that paypal account. I disconnected it from my bank account and even phoned my bank and told them not to allow paypal to ever delve into my account and try to get money.

The paypal account stood there at minus £130. I occasionally got an email from paypal saying that my account has fallen below zero and needs to be "immediately restored".

I ignored the emails.

Today I got a letter from debt collectors. Paypal have forwarded my details onto them and are demanding payment.

I'm absolutely furious. Someone is gonna pay for this, but it sure as hell isn't gonna be me. (Well I might have to pay it off to stop them repossessing our house, but I'm getting my revenge some way or another.)

Default No proof...

As a past collection agent in Canada I can let you know of a few secrets.

First, they do not have proof that you owe something. Say to the collection company that you need to see proof that you owe for a service or product for you have no record of the debt. If they say they do not have to prove anything then tell them you will go to the papers and complain to your member of parliament (government official). They will need to get proof of the service/product purchase with YOUR SIGNATURE on it. If it is just a paper return from your bank then just say "They tried to debit illegally from my bank and I refused it"

I now work with a bank and I know that if they (PP) receive a number of complaints they will be refused debit authority from the Payments Association (CPA or Canadian Payments Association here in Canada).

Remember, when the dog bites you should bite back by taking a bigger chunk then they did!

Default To clarify things...

Do not represent yourself as a member of parliament. As stated, say you will complain to YOUR member of parliament.

Check your local government papers for a Collections Agency Act. Each province in Canada has one. It outlines what the collection companies can and cannot do. It also outlines a way of conduct.
